Old Hill Street Police Station building is a historic landmark located in the Downtown Core of Singapore.
It was designed in the Straits Settlements architectural style, featuring arched windows and decorative columns.
The colourful windows are arranged in a gradient, giving the building a unique and lively appearance.
Today, the building no longer functions as a police station but houses the Ministry of Communications and Information (MCI) and the Info-communications Media Development Authority (IMDA).
Located near Fort Canning Park and the Singapore River, it is easily accessible by public transport.
